Output 24899fa043a2540db1c4d895ad36c0aebc04b65c11aeeb92fa2e8463a92bcdf9:3

value
2682810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9524da20312ec2fbdae8bdfc0893772167e989b6 OP_EQUAL
address
MMVm4YBmmWQtNz5AYWMqynd9v867ggu7wm
transaction
24899fa043a2540db1c4d895ad36c0aebc04b65c11aeeb92fa2e8463a92bcdf9
spent
true